Great Dane Terre Haute Plant is looking for a HR ADMIN/SPECIALIST that performs generalist administrative functions that support compliance with company employment policies, legislative employment requirements and recordkeeping best practices. The position also provides assistance to employees with questions related to individual information and company policies.
1. Data entry of all new employees into ADP system. Entry into systems of all data changes related to employees personal information, job assignment or employment status.
2. Maintains personnel files, ensures that all required documents are on file in the appropriate location.
3. Screen candidates and execute efforts that support exempt hiring needs to drive business growth.
4. Processes terminations ensuring that documentation of reason for termination of employment and all completion of all related company processes are recorded. Coordinates issue of final payroll to departing employee.
5. Coordinates and communicates payroll adjustments for each pay period to include one-off adjustments and other misc. adjustments.
6. Generates and distributes reports related to manning, hire and termination numbers and labor related information requests.
7. Explains payroll calculations and investigates payroll discrepancies for employees with payroll questions.
Secondary Job Function: 1. Assists with completing unemployment claims responses.
2. Acts as 3rd party witness for disciplinary action or incident investigation meetings.
3. Coordinates ordering and stocking of departmental office supplies.
4. Additional duties as assigned.
